Designated learning institutions


Provinces and territories approve (or “designate”) schools that can enrol
international students. These schools are known as designated learning
institutions (DLI).

If you need a study permit, your acceptance letter must be from a DLI. If
it isn’t, we will refuse your application.

All primary and secondary schools in Canada are DLIs. You can search a
list of the post-secondary schools, such as colleges and universities, and
language schools that have been designated.

How to apply to a school, college


or university
Once you choose a school, college or university, you must apply to go
there. Every school has different rules on how to apply.

Make sure you apply at least

six months in advance if you want to study at a primary or secondary


school, or
a year in advance for a post-secondary program

Contact the school where you want to study to learn how to apply. They
will give you the list of all the documents you need to send them. Your
school will be able to tell you about

the cost to apply


tuition fees
health insurance
rent and how much it costs to live in Canada
language tests

Fill out the application forms for the school or schools of your choice.
Follow their instructions to submit them.

If the school admits you as a student, they will send you a letter of
acceptance. You need this letter to apply for a study permit.

Health insurance
The Government of Canada doesn’t pay for the medical costs of foreign
students.

Health coverage for foreign students is different depending on where


you live. Contact the school you are applying to for more information
about health insurance.
